Sourcing guidance for Closet

What are the key material specifications to consider when sourcing closets for B2B projects?

Buyers should prioritize E1 or E0 grade MDF/HDF or Plywood to ensure low formaldehyde emissions and environmental compliance. For high-end projects, solid wood (Oak, Walnut) offers superior longevity. Ensure the melamine or lacquer finish is scratch-resistant and has a thickness of at least 18mm for side panels to prevent warping under heavy loads.

How can I evaluate the quality of closet hardware and accessories?

Hardware is the most common point of failure. Specify soft-close hinges and drawer slides (e.g., Blum or high-quality local equivalents) tested for at least 50,000 open-close cycles. For sliding closets, verify that the aluminum tracks are powder-coated and the rollers feature anti-jump mechanisms with a load capacity of 80kg or more.

What functional features are essential for modern commercial or residential closets?

Modern sourcing should focus on modular designs that allow for adjustable shelving and hanging rods. Integration of LED sensor lighting (DC12V/24V), built-in jewelry drawers with velvet lining, and pull-out trouser racks significantly increases the product's market value and end-user satisfaction.

What compliance standards must closets meet for international markets?

For the US market, ensure compliance with CARB Phase 2 or TSCA Title VI regarding formaldehyde. For the EU, products must meet REACH regulations and EN 14749 for safety and strength requirements. Always request FSC certification if your brand emphasizes sustainable sourcing.

Cross-Border Purchasing & Risk Management for Closets

How can I mitigate the risk of damage during international shipping?

Closets are bulky and prone to edge damage. Insist on Flat-Pack (RTA) packaging with 5-layer corrugated cartons, EPE foam edge protectors, and honeycomb board buffers. For LCL shipments, require wooden palletization or crating to prevent compression damage from other cargo.

What is the best strategy for negotiating with closet manufacturers on Made-in-China.com?

Focus on the Total Landed Cost rather than just the unit price. Negotiate for spare hardware parts (1-2% extra) to be included at no cost. For large orders, request a staggered payment schedule (e.g., 30% deposit, 70% after passing a third-party pre-shipment inspection).

How do I ensure the closet dimensions and assembly will be accurate?

Request CAD or 3D Max shop drawings for approval before production begins. Ensure the supplier provides a detailed assembly manual or installation video. For customized projects, it is highly recommended to have the supplier perform a trial assembly in the factory and send photos/videos of the finished unit.

What should I look for in a reliable closet supplier's profile?

Prioritize Audited Suppliers on Made-in-China.com who have a proven track record in furniture exports. Check for ISO 9001 certification and look for suppliers who offer OEM/ODM capabilities, as this indicates they have the engineering depth to handle custom specifications and technical troubleshooting.
